When you’re struggling with a bad credit score, more than having access to the right tools to repair it, you must look for resources to help you keep it that way.

First of all, this is an unsecured card. What that means is that you’ll get a $300+ spending limit without the need of a security deposit.

Then, not only does Mission Lane report your activity to the three main bureaus, but offers access to credit-building education to help you on your journey. 

  • Credit Score: All credit levels are welcome to apply.
  • APR: 26.99% – 29.99% variable.
  • Annual Fee: Between $0 and $59 depending on a number of factors like credit history and income.
  • Fees: 3% cash advance and foreign transaction fees. Max late fee up to $35.
  • Welcome bonus: There is no current offer.
  • Rewards: None.

You can even pre-qualify first without a hard inquiry to see if the card is available to you. Soft inquiries don’t cause further harm to your score. With the Visa coverage, you’ll regain purchasing power to shop anywhere in the world Visa is accepted.

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card: how does it work?

using the Mission Lane Visa® Card to build credit
Use this card responsibly and you can build a credit score. Source: Freepik

The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card is issued by TAB Bank, Member FDIC. It has international Visa coverage and made to help people with a bad score or limited history to get ahead in their financial life.

The card charges an annual fee up to $59 – which can be waived depending on your credit history, income and pending debts.

There’s an unsecured credit limit of $300+ eligible for increase upon review after 6 consecutively on time payments.

It has a 26.99% – 29.99% variable APR, which is on the heavy side, but won’t be cause to worry if you manage to pay your balance in full every month.

You can also use this card to make international purchases, but beware of the 3% foreign transaction fee.

The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card offers all cardholders easy management through a mobile app.

Plus, you’ll also have free access to your credit score and credit-building education resources to keep you educated on your finances. 

Finally, TAB Bank reports all account activities to the three main credit bureaus in the country. With responsible use, you’ll be able to notice an improvement on your score over time. 

Significant benefits and disadvantages of the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card

Every credit product has its highlights and lowlights, and the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card is no different. Check below to learn more about the pros and cons. 

Benefits

  • All credit types are welcome to apply;
  • Helps to reestablish your credit score with good use;
  • Offers credit-building education tools;
  • Doesn’t require a security deposit;
  • Features a mobile app for easy account management.

Disadvantages

  • May charge an annual fee;
  • Has a high APR on purchases;
  • No rewards on purchases or sign-up bonuses.

Is a good credit score required for applicants?

The Mission Lane Visa® Credit Card is for people with bad/fair credit scores and a limited credit history. You can pre-qualify and get the card to help you on your credit building journey.
